Bmw X2 - 2022
64.0 faults per 100 tests
Year average for all cars of 2022 is 71.1 faults per 100 tests
Dataset: MOT tests in Great Britain (period: 2024-01-01 to 2025-09-10) for Bmw X2, model year 2022.
Sample size: 1,941 cars, 2,590 tests and 1,658 recorded faults.

Quick summary
Total: 1,941 cars
The 2022 BMW X2 has an overall defect rate of 64 per 100 vehicles, which is 9% lower than the average car of the same year, indicating better reliability. Notably, the model shows significant strengths in several categories, including brakes, where it has 16% defects compared to the average of 30%, and lights and electrics, where it stands at 6% against an average of 11%. Mileage data reveals that defects are highest in the lowest mileage range, but they decrease substantially as mileage increases, which is a common trend. Overall, the BMW X2 excels in areas like body structure and equipment, demonstrating a solid performance compared to its peers.
